Current Legal Framework
In Kazakhstan, the legislation surrounding online gambling is primarily governed by the Law of the Republic of Kazakhstan on Gambling Activities. This legislation was enacted to regulate all forms of gambling, including online casinos, sports betting, and lotteries. The primary objective of this law is to ensure that all gambling activities are conducted fairly and transparently, while also protecting players from potential fraud and abuse.
Licensing Requirements
Before launching an online casino app in Kazakhstan, operators must obtain a license from the Ministry of Culture and Sports, which oversees the gambling sector. The licensing process involves a thorough examination of the operator’s business practices, financial stability, and compliance with local laws.
The requirements for obtaining a license include:
- Submitting a detailed business plan outlining the proposed operations.
- Providing proof of the operator’s financial solvency.
- Undergoing background checks on the company’s owners and key personnel.
- Ensuring that any gaming software used in the online casino is certified and complies with technical standards.
Failure to adhere to these licensing requirements can result in severe penalties, including hefty fines and the revocation of the operating license.
Regulatory Authorities
In Kazakhstan, the regulatory authority responsible for enforcing gambling laws is the Ministry of Culture and Sports. This ministry plays a pivotal role in monitoring the activities of licensed operators to ensure compliance with existing laws and regulations. Additionally, the Ministry is tasked with preventing illegal gambling operations, conducting inspections, and imposing sanctions on non-compliant entities.
Another critical aspect is the establishment of the online gambling zone in the city of Borovoe, which is a dedicated location for legal gambling activities, including online casinos. Operators wishing to establish an online platform must ensure that their services are offered in this zone to comply with the national law.

Taxation in the Online Gambling Industry
Taxation policies also play a crucial role in the legal aspects of online casino apps in Kazakhstan. Licensed operators are required to pay a gambling tax, which is calculated based on the revenue generated from gambling activities. The tax rates can vary depending on the type of gambling service offered, but significant revenue contributions from licensed operators are expected to support public services and development projects in the country.
Players may also be subject to taxation on their winnings, depending on the amounts and local laws. Thus, understanding tax obligations is an important aspect of gambling for both operators and players, who should consult with legal experts for guidance.
Player Protection and Responsible Gambling
Regulatory frameworks in Kazakhstan also emphasize player protection and responsible gambling practices. Operators are required to implement measures to promote responsible gambling, including:
- Offering self-exclusion options for players who may be at risk of gambling addiction.
- Implementing age verification processes to ensure that only individuals of legal gambling age can access the online casino.
- Providing resources and support for players who may require assistance with gambling-related issues.
These measures are essential to create a balanced and safe environment for online gaming, promoting fair play and protecting vulnerable individuals.
